Renewable Natural Gas Market size was valued at USD 20.28 Billion in 2024 and is poised to grow from USD 26.36 Billion in 2025 to USD 215.06 Billion by 2033, growing at a CAGR of 30% during the forecast period (2026-2033).
The renewable natural gas (RNG) market is experiencing significant growth driven by rising concerns about greenhouse gas emissions, dwindling fossil fuel resources, and the need for climate change mitigation. Key insights reveal that RNG is increasingly adopted in transportation, residential, industrial, and commercial sectors as it effectively replaces traditional natural gas while mitigating methane emissions from landfills and agriculture. Government regulations, incentives, and carbon pricing are catalyzing investments in RNG production and distribution infrastructure. The competitive landscape features established energy providers, waste management companies, and emerging startups dedicated to RNG. Collaborative ventures and strategic investments are prevalent as stakeholders seek to enhance their market presence. The shift towards cleaner energy sources positions the RNG market for continued expansion, offering substantial economic and environmental advantages.

Driver of the Renewable Natural Gas Market
The growth of the Renewable Natural Gas (RNG) market is significantly influenced by favorable regulatory frameworks, incentives, and mandates. Various countries have established renewable energy targets that encourage the transition to cleaner energy sources, while the U.S. has implemented measures like the Renewable Fuel Standard (RFS) to promote the use of renewable fuels. These supportive policies create an environment conducive to the development and adoption of RNG, incentivizing investment and innovation within the sector. As governments increasingly prioritize sustainability and environmental responsibility, the demand for renewable energy solutions, including RNG, continues to rise, bolstering market growth.
Restraints in the Renewable Natural Gas Market
The adoption of Renewable Natural Gas (RNG) faces significant challenges due to inadequate infrastructure for its production, distribution, and utilization. This lack of essential facilities is particularly pronounced in areas where established natural gas networks are not in place, creating obstacles for integrating RNG into existing energy systems. Without the necessary infrastructure, the efficient deployment and widespread use of RNG become difficult, limiting its potential to contribute to sustainable energy solutions. Consequently, regions that could benefit from RNG are unable to fully leverage its advantages, which could otherwise play a crucial role in transitioning to cleaner energy sources.
Market Trends of the Renewable Natural Gas Market
The Renewable Natural Gas (RNG) market is witnessing a significant trend towards the integration of RNG into existing natural gas infrastructures. This seamless incorporation facilitates enhanced distribution and utilization across various sectors, including residential, commercial, and industrial applications. As demand for sustainable energy solutions grows, stakeholders are prioritizing RNG to reduce carbon footprints while leveraging existing pipeline systems. This approach not only optimizes infrastructure investments but also bolsters energy security and diversification. The market is increasingly characterized by collaborations between RNG producers and utility companies, fostering a transition to a greener energy landscape while ensuring reliability and accessibility for consumers.
